
Erode, located in Tamil Nadu, is a city known for its textile industry, particularly its production of cotton fabrics, which has earned it the title of "Textile City of Tamil Nadu." The city is a major trading center for agricultural products like turmeric, and it has earned a reputation for producing high-quality turmeric, which is a significant export commodity. Erode is also home to several historical landmarks, including temples such as the Periyar Eshwar Temple and the Bhavani Sangameswarar Temple, which reflect the city?s rich religious heritage. Agriculture is a major contributor to the economy, with crops like cotton, paddy, and groundnuts being widely cultivated. The city?s cultural life is marked by the celebration of festivals like Pongal and Diwali, and traditional Tamil folk music and dance are an important part of local life. Erode is also a growing hub for education, with numerous schools, colleges, and vocational institutes. The district?s industrial, agricultural, and cultural diversity make it a key part of Tamil Nadu?s economy. Erode?s textile industries, combined with its historical and cultural richness, make it a prominent city in the region.
